About the role

Description

The Administrative Assistant is responsible for assisting the Office of Institutional Advancement in managing the daily affairs of the office. This position will provide a wide range of clerical duties such as answering phone calls, organizing files, providing excellent customer service, collecting and maintaining accurate information in Raisers Edge, and event preparation. This position will excel at problem solving, decision making and understand the importance of handling confidential information.

Requirements

Essential Functions:

The statements below are intended to describe the principal duties of the person or persons assigned to this job. They are not intended to be an exhaustive list of all job duties and responsibilities.

  • Schedule appointments and follows ups while keeping the Institutional Advancement office informed on upcoming events
  • Assist with tracking projects and fundraising initiatives for the Institutional Advancement Office
  • Assists in the communication with donors, alumni, volunteer members, retirees, and faculty and staff
  • Manages incoming and outgoing correspondence and messages accurately and in a timely manner
  • Assists in preparing mailing lists and labels for special events and/or campaigns
  • Works closely with the marketing department for event invitations, newsletters and all outgoing letters
  • Responsible for personalized handwritten communications to alumni on a daily and monthly basis including sending out appropriate gifts, birthday cards, and condolence communications
  • Creates, maintains and searches databases and uses data to produce lists, mailing labels, and letters
  • Acts as the administrative contact for volunteers, trustees and major accounts while having a positive and professional demeanor
  • Uphold positive relationships with campus staff, faculty, leadership, students and alumni
  • Interact with faculty and staff regarding the usage of the donor database ensuring that accurate information is maintained
  • Assists with gift entry and Member Solutions
  • Conducts Donor research, wealth screenings and Stewardship activities
  • Assistant with event preparation, registration lists, coordinating with vendors, tracking RSVPs and follow up tasks
  • Enter and track purchasing orders for the Institutional Advancement Office to ensure invoices are paid in a timely manner
  • Reconcile bank statements each month and maintain accurate records of receipts
  • Work closely with Student Ambassadors for campus events
  • Organize travel for the Development staff


Job Requirements:

Education: High School Diploma or equivalent and commiserate experience required, bachelor’s degree preferred. 

Experience: A minimum of three to five years’ experience in administrative support required, experience supporting a non-profit in development preferred. 

Skills: Excellent written and verbal communication skills, editing and proofreading skills, high level of competency in Microsoft Office. Attention to detail and strong data entry skills. Must be highly organized, project oriented and the ability to multi-task. Experience with Raiser’s Edge preferred.
